数据迁移工具汇报.pptxV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
;;在油田信息化建设中,数据是核心关键,是信息化建设最有价值的资产。而将业务应用产生的有价值的数据,在整个油田信息网中可控、及时、安全的流转,是避免数据孤岛的关键。 数据及业务人员在数据管理过程中,经常要面对的是数据的迁移、数据的备份、数据的清洗及数据的同步等需求。而如果利用数据库现有功能去实现,技术要求高、操作复杂、灵活性差、功能受限。;目前常规数据迁移的方法一般有三种: 开发专用的迁移程序 优点是操作简单,操作人员只需要会使用迁移软件即可。缺点是需要一定开发周期,需要研发人员配合,灵活性差,需求一旦变更,程序就要改造。 借助Oracle等数据库的功能实现 需要专业的数据库管理员或数据库开发人员才能实现,技术要求高,且难以实现不同类型数据库之间的迁移。 采用GoldenGate等第三方的迁移软件 优点是功能相对完善,效率高。缺点是配置复杂,一般业务人员难以掌握,按点收费,费用高昂。;通过对相关业务分析,XX数据迁移工具设计主要具备三大功能,即数据迁移、数据同步、文件导入。数据迁移应该具备以下特点: 易用性好,完全的可视化操作界面,方便上手。 功能强大,可满足数据管理中的各种数据迁移需求。 运行稳定。 高效。 ;如何支持不同类型数据库之间的数据迁移及同步。 如何支持数据库结构不同时,数据的迁移及同步。 如何支持在迁移及同步过程中做复杂的数据处理及转换计算。 怎么解决数据增量同步,并确保高效及实时性。 如何实现软件的易用性。 ;;二、技术方案;二、技术方案;二、技术方案;二、技术方案;二、技术方案;二、技术方案;;数据迁移系统; 将源数据库现有数据根据设定的筛选条件,按照数据表或是字段对应规则,手动或是自动定时将数据迁移至目标数据库。;运行结果; 数据同步是指源数据库发生变动时,目标数据库在最短的时间内同步相应变动。 通过实时捕获变化数据,根据表和字段对应关系将改变的数据同步到源头数据总库,实时保持源数据库与目标数据库数据的一致性。; 按照捕获数据变化方式,同步分为解析归档日志同步、触发器同步及CDC同步三种模式。;; 解析日志同步中,解析日志和数据入库采用异步模式,避免了网络出现异常后同步数据丢失。; 1、首先通过上次解析的日志文件SEQ号判断并获取新增的日志文件列表。 2、然后通过上次解析日志的SCN号判断该日志文件要解析的日志记录。 3、最后解析日志文件,并过滤解析的日志记录,缓存成多个固定大小的数据文件。 ;三、功能介绍;3、文件导入; 迁移工具所有设置和操作都支持可视化,都有相应的界面供用户操作,其中表与表对应关系、字段对应关系等操作支持拖拽设置,符合大多数用户操作习惯,具有用户使用方便、易用、直观等特点。 数据迁移或同步详细日志可视化显示,方便用户随时查看及对对应状态的实时检测。; 数据迁移工具支持数据迁移过程中用到的迁移参数的设置,包括迁移模式、是否启动多线程迁移等参数。; 数据迁移工具是一个综合管理工具,可以同时维护、运行多个不同的数据迁移的项目,并通过项目的方式,分类展示出来。; 通过数据库对应关系,搭建多个不同库之间的虚拟链路关系,设置数据源与目标。;; 支持迁移事件,包括迁移前事件、迁移后事件、插入前事件、插入后事件、修改前事件、修改后事件,事件中支持执行sql语句和存储过程。; 如果源数据来源比较复杂,需要通过sql语句来获取或是通过存储过程来获取,就需要建立虚拟表。; 表对应关系搭建好后,需设置字段的对应关系,即源表是什么字段,对应目标表是什么字段,支持字段的计算及合并。; 字段设置中支持普通字段、常量、sql表达式(源)、代码转换、随机Guid、sql表达式(目录)等类型。; 设置迁移条件,只把满足要求的数据迁移过去,支持变量替换,支持字段拖放操作。; 对于一个项目可定制多个任务,任务触发条件可不一样,运行时间也各自独立控制。; 对于已经制定任务的运行、启闭操作。对数据迁移运行信息进行详细的查询。; 数据迁移同步工具保存着所有数据表同步运行详细日志,用户可以按照日期对日志进行分页查询。; 自动调度状态中显示任务或是同步运行详细信息,包括任务下次运行时间、上次运行结果和同步实时运行状态及结果等信息。; 迁移工具还支持远程调用功能,通常为了迁移工具运行的稳定性,会把迁移工具部署到服务器上,这样用户操作不太方便,所以迁移工具提供客户端远程调用工具,来运行迁移任务。; 文件操作包括Excel、DBF文件的导入与导出

文档评论(0)

339910001 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档